Overview of the CNC Manufacturing Process

The goal of CNC manufacturing is to take CAD files created by the CAD subteam and use them to machine parts that can be used by the build subteam for robot assembly. This requires a good understanding of how to use a CNC machine, as well as an emphasis on safety to avoid damaged parts and injury.
